Book Overview

Capital's Food Regime traces India's integration into the global food regime and reveals the consequences for the country's different classes of labour.


The book is an in-depth study of agrarian transformations in contemporary India through the lens of food regime analysis. While the food regime approach has emphasized global-scale studies, this book breaks new ground in downscaling the approach to account for specific historical-geographical cases. Jakobsen thus develops an innovative Marxist approach to food regime analysis that challenges prevailing scholarly accounts in Agrarian Studies and beyond.
